Output 73c89f3ef2362209c9906ef32cae2995fbca9f55973fb3ce411586f8116ba64a:2

value
30565258
script pubkey
OP_HASH160 OP_PUSHBYTES_20 024625bb7d8bd59a160dc8adad4d75a5344f64dd OP_EQUAL
address
31u3JrTyzoLbKMuqYatTyhLnQkb6Knc3Xf
transaction
73c89f3ef2362209c9906ef32cae2995fbca9f55973fb3ce411586f8116ba64a
confirmations
298215
spent
true